Output 66c2f35a3a62afd39a32f318b543406d8c2692272507dc23f5eea523e373c06b:0

value
3054754
script pubkey
OP_0 OP_PUSHBYTES_20 609ec92657f77394e639bdf473e05f964e8ab81a
address
bc1qvz0vjfjh7aeefe3ehh688czlje8g4wq64hnce2
transaction
66c2f35a3a62afd39a32f318b543406d8c2692272507dc23f5eea523e373c06b
confirmations
151858
spent
true